Oncobox Method for Scoring Efficiencies of Anticancer Drugs Based on Gene Expression Data
Victor Tkachev1, Maxim Sorokin1,2, Andrew Garazha1
1Omicsway Corp., Walnut, CA, USA.
The Oncobox method assesses anticancer drug effectiveness using gene expression data. This approach analyzes molecular pathways and drug targets, aiding drug discovery and development.

Main Methods:
- Utilizes high-throughput gene expression data (microarray, RNA sequencing).
- Analyzes intracellular molecular pathways activation.
- Measures expressions of molecular target genes for ATDs.
- Requires normal (control) expression profiles and annotated databases.
